Do you love making a difference in your community? The Child and Youth Care program (CYC) is your gateway into supporting the lives of children, youth and families. Through this innovative program, you will receive training in areas such as counselling, addiction, sexuality, mental health and special needs.

Apply your learning and your passion to get a head start on your future. This three-year advanced diploma program offers four levels of field placements in the community, small class sizes and a cooperative learning environment designed to prepare you to excel in your career helping others

Meet the unique needs of all communities.

The CYC program at Sault College is one of the only Child and Youth Care programs in Ontario to offer a formalized course in working with gender and sexuality and minority children, youth and their families. We want to help you make the biggest impact!

Earn a university degree in as little as 8 months! Introducing our Two Plus Two Pathway to Degree option with Algoma University. Students can join us for two years and will only need two more with our partnering University to earn a Bachelor of Arts in Psychology.

About this course

Child and Youth Care practitioners work in treatment centres, group homes, schools, social agencies, hospitals, children`s aid societies, youth programs, recreational programs, youth justice facilities, and community development. Some choose self-employment. Sault College Child and Youth Care graduates are well-trained in their profession and have the skills needed to get hired (e.g. interview skills, resume-writing skills, job-search skills). They enter a competitive market and succeed.

Ontario Secondary School diploma with Grade 12 English (C) ENG4C, or mature student status.

Course programme

Semester 1
  • CMM110 - 3 College Communication Skills
  • CYC100 - 3 Introduction to Human Relations
  • CYC103 - 3 Relational Practice in CYC
  • CYC104 - 3 CYC Methods I: Intro. to the Profession
  • PSY102 - 3 Introduction to Psychology
  • GEN100 - 3 Global Citizenship
Semester 2
  • CMM225 - 3 Human Services Communication
  • CYC152 - 3 Therapeutic Recreation
  • CYC155 - 3 CYC Methods II: Behavioural Intervention
  • CYC156 - 3 Child and Adolescent Development
  • CYC157 - 3 Addictions: Evidence Informed Practice
  • CYC158 - 4 Community Practicum I: Prep and Seminar
Semester 3
  • CYC202 - 3 Counselling Skills I
  • CYC203 - 3 Group Dynamics I
  • CYC206 - 3 CYC Methods III: Case Management
  • CYC207 - 2 Legislation and Social Issues
  • CYC208 - 7 Community Practicum II
  • CYC210 - 2 Integrated Seminar II

Semester 4
  • CYC251 - 3 Group Dynamics II
  • CYC252 - 3 Youth In Conflict with the Law
  • CYC253 - 3 Counselling Skills II
  • CYC254 - 3 Abuse and Family Violence
  • CYC255 - 3 Child and Adolescent Mental Health I
  • GEN110 - 3 Student Selected General Education
Note: *This student-selected general education course code indicates a general-education course is taken in this semester. Students will choose from a selection of courses (details) prior to the semester in which the student-selected general education course is to be taken.


Semester 5
  • CYC256 - 3 Grief and Loss in Child and Youth Care
  • CYC304 - 3 Working with Diverse Populations
  • CYC305 - 3 CYC Methods IV: Trauma Focused Therapies
  • CYC307 - 3 Child and Adolescent Mental Health II
  • CYC308 - 7 Community Practicum III
  • CYC310 - 2 Integrated Seminar III

Semester 6
  • CYC354 - 4 Community Development
  • CYC357 - 3 Gender and Sexuality in CYC
  • CYC358 - 7 Community Practicum IV
  • CYC360 - 2 Integrated Seminar IV
  • SSC110 - 3 Introduction to Indigenous Canada
